Camela Leierth - Biography

Camela Leierth is a storyteller and has used numerous mediums to showcase her artistry. She has been working as a professional in the entertainment industry since she was five years old, as a child actress and singer. Camela was born in Sweden and moved to the United States, at the age of 15. Her father is an accomplished playwright and has worked closely with director, Eva Bergman, the daughter of legendary director, Ingmar Bergman. Camela attributes everything she knows about play-writing to her father. Growing up with artists and actively studying the arts and its many facets provided her with the experience and skill-set to direct an array of Off-Broadway theater, plays, live-performances and music-videos in NYC, Paris, and London. Camela received great fame in music and was an artist in Sweden in the late 90's. She is a also a professional singer and composer, as she has worked and toured with the most recognized artists and composers of our times. Leierth is a co-author of the song "Walking On Air" which is on Katy Perry's album Prism. As a screenwriter and director, Camela has a unique style and is able to illustrate her vision by drawing upon her vibrant life experiences. She lives and works in Los Angeles, CA.
